Card games predate computers, but they have taken on a whole new life thanks to computer games. For instance, solitaire games are much easier and more fun when a computer does the dealing and keeps everything organized.
In this chapter, we’ll look at three card games, starting off simply with Higher or Lower. Then we look at two casino-style games in Video Poker and Blackjack.
